On Saturday, people gathered under the glorious sunshine at Eastney Beach in Portsmouth for a big clean-up along the coastline.
Volunteers came throughout the morning to take part in the event.

Hide AdEvent organiser Lara Skingsley, from the Marine Conservation Society, said: ‘It has been really lively.
‘People are all here for different reasons because some focus on cleaning the environment, and others become fascinated by the wildlife here.
‘These beach cleans are a great way to help the environment and meet new people are the same time.’
